VALENTINE'S DAY
• 14th February• Candy, flowers, and chocolates• Who is St Valentine?
• Roots in Christian and Roman tradition
LEGEND 1
• Valentine was a priest• 3rd cent., Rome• Caesar wanted all young men to be
soldiers• Valentine disagreed and secretly
performed marriages• Valentine was killed
LEGEND 2
• Valentine was a prisoner• He sent the 1st Valentine’s letter• Signature was: ‘FROM YOUR VALENTINE’’
• We cannot know which legend is true
WHY 14TH FEBRUARY?
• In memory of Valentine's death • Pagan festival• The beginning of spring
GREAT BRITAIN
• 17th century• All social classes • Giving each other gifts or notes • The end of the 18th century - printed
cards
AMERICA
• The middle of the 19th cent – Valentine cards
• Today - 1 billion Valentine cards • Valentine’s Day = the 2nd largest
card sending holiday
WHERE IS VALENTINE’S DAY CELEBRATED?
• Canada • Mexico • Australia • Becoming popular around Europe
• The oldest card is in British Museum, London
• ½ of the Americans buy Valentine cards
SLOVENIA
• Valentine’s Day is a new thing• GREGORJEVO - 12th March• The beginning of spring• ‘Birds get married on GREGORJEVO
• Not all celebrate• Some buy small gifts• Gifts for everyone they find special• Flowers, chocolates, cards, soft
toys…
